Iron Sponge Process | Oil and Gas Separator

The iron sponge process uses the chemical reaction of ferric oxide with H2S to sweeten gas streams. This process is applied to gases with low H2S concentrations (300 ppm) operating at low to moderate pressures (50500 psig).

Rust chemistry1Rust chemistry2

Rust chemistry

Rusting of iron consists of the formation of hydrated oxide, Fe(OH) 3, FeO(OH), or even Fe 2 O 2 O. It is an electrochemical process which requires the presence of water, oxygen and an electrolyte. In the absence of any one of these rusting does not occur to any significant extent. In air, a relative humidity of over 50% provides the ...

Rust chemistry1Rust chemistry2

Rust chemistry

Hydrogen ions are being consumed by the process. As the iron corrodes, the pH in the droplet rises. Hydroxide ions (OH) appear in water as the hydrogen ion concentration falls. They react with the iron(II) ions to produce insoluble iron(II) hydroxides or green rust: Fe 2+ (aq) + 2OH(aq) → Fe(OH) 2 (s)

Chemical characteristics of iron and steel slag : NIPPON ...

Chemical composition of iron and steel slag. The primary components of iron and steel slag are limestone (CaO) and silica (SiO 2 ). Other components of blast furnace slag include alumina (Alsub>2O 3) and magnesium oxide (MgO), as well as a small amount of sulfur (S), while steelmaking slag contains iron oxide (FeO) and magnesium oxide (MgO).

Iron And Steel Production

Iron is produced in blast furnaces by the reduction of iron bearing materials with a hot gas. The large, refractory lined furnace is charged through its top with iron as ore, pellets, and/or sinter; flux as limestone, dolomite, and sinter; and coke for fuel.

Extraction Of Iron SlideShare

May 22, 2009· Extraction Of Iron. Occurrence of Iron Iron is very reactive and is found in nature in form of its oxides, carbonates and sulphates. The main ores are: i) Haematite (Fe2O3) ii) Magnetite (Fe3O4) iii) Iron Pyrites (FeS2) o The main iron ore is Haematite (iron (III) oxide Fe2O3). o The iron ore contains impurities, mainly silica (silicon dioxide).
